How to Make Chili Apple Tequila Chutney

  1. **Prep the Ingredients:** Dice 2 medium apples (about 2 cups diced). Mince 2 tablespoons of fresh ginger.
  2. **Sauté the Apples:** Melt 4 tablespoons of butter in a heavy-bottomed saucepan over medium heat. Once the butter lightly foams, add the diced apples and minced ginger.
  3. **Bloom the Spices:** Cook for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the apples begin to soften. Stir in 2 tablespoons of brown sugar and 1 tablespoon of chili powder.
  4. **Add the Liquids:** Add 1/4 cup of good quality tequila and 1/2 cup of apple cider vinegar.
  5. **Reduce and Simmer:** Bring to a simmer, then reduce the heat to low and cook for 15-20 minutes, or until the apple cider vinegar has reduced by about half and the chutney has thickened slightly.
  6. **Season to Taste:** Remove from heat and stir in 1 tablespoon of lime juice and salt to taste. Adjust the chili powder to your desired level of spiciness.
